puqiong233

导航

[SQL Server] 查询一段代码片段存在于哪段存过、触发器、函数的方法

SELECT A.NAME 来源名称,B.TEXT 代码内容,
    CASE
        WHEN A.XTYPE='V' THEN '视图'
        WHEN A.XTYPE='P' THEN '存储过程'
        WHEN A.XTYPE='FN' THEN '标量函数'
        WHEN A.XTYPE='TF' THEN '表函数'
        WHEN A.XTYPE='TR' THEN '触发器'
        ELSE A.XTYPE
    END 类型
FROM SYSOBJECTS A INNER JOIN SYSCOMMENTS B ON A.ID=B.ID
WHERE B.TEXT LIKE '%这里写需要查询的代码片段%'
ORDER BY 类型

 

posted on 2023-05-04 11:12  纯纯的牛马  阅读(44)  评论(0编辑  收藏  举报